Historic Trials of Soldiers

Speakers: General Sir Nick Parker KCB CBE DL
other speaker tbc
Moderator: Sir Geoffrey Nice KC

Does the proposed Northern Ireland Troubles Bill provide genuine legal certainty for those lawfully deployed by the State, or does it institutionalise continued exposure to investigation and prosecution under a different mechanism? The speakers will examine whether the proposed legislation is fair and proportionate or whether it risks undermining the spirit of the Good Friday Agreement and the State's ability to draw a line under the Troubles and move forwards (for both victims and veterans) in the spirit of truth and reconciliation.
